New Berlin had to hit the road for their first game and it wasn't the result they were hoping for. They fell 2-0 to the Sacred Heart-Griffin Cyclones on Monday. The Pretzels were not able to make up for their defeat to the Cyclones from their previous meeting back in August of 2024.
The final score came out to 25-4, 25-12.
Jenna McGath paced New Berlin's offense, picking up two kills. McGath got some help from Molly Preckwinkle and her two assists. Finally, Mayci Davis kept New Berlin's defense grounded, leading the team with two blocks.
New Berlin will look to takes advantage of their home court for the first time this season as they takes on North Greene at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Sacred Heart-Griffin, they will hit the road for the first time this season to face off against MacArthur at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
